要优化Ubuntu文件系统的性能,可以采取以下几种方法:
sudo swapon --show查看swap分区大小和使用情况,若swap分区小于物理内存的50%,建议增加其大小。zram软件包添加压缩的内存驱动器并配置为交换空间。tune2fs工具调整文件系统的检查间隔和周期。vm.swappiness:该参数调整交换分区的使用级别,默认值为60,建议值为10-30。可以通过sysctl查看参数当前值,并使用sudo sysctl -w修改参数值。在Ubuntu中,可以使用sudo vim /etc/sysctl.conf永久更改参数值。net.ipv4.tcp_fin_timeout(定义等待TCP连接关闭的时间)和fs.file-max(定义可以打开的最大文件描述符数量)。/tmp目录下创建的文件存储在SSD硬盘上。fsck工具进行文件系统检查,并通过tune2fs调整检查间隔。top、htop、iostat等监控系统的CPU和磁盘I/O性能,及时发现并解决性能瓶颈。通过上述方法,可以显著提升Ubuntu文件系统的性能,使其更加高效和稳定。